diff --git a/tasks/build/index.js b/tasks/build/index.js index f136f89179ea2..0f7c4d00de247 100644 --- a/tasks/build/index.js +++ b/tasks/build/index.js @@ -1,7 +1,7 @@ module.exports = function (grunt) { let { flatten } = require('lodash'); - grunt.registerTask('build', 'Build packages', function (arg) { + grunt.registerTask('build', 'Build packages', function () { grunt.task.run(flatten([ '_build:getProps', 'clean:build', @@ -23,7 +23,7 @@ module.exports = function (grunt) { '_build:downloadNodeBuilds:finish', '_build:versionedLinks', '_build:archives', - (grunt.option('os-packages') || arg === 'ospackages') ? [ + grunt.option('os-packages') ? [ '_build:pleaseRun', '_build:osPackages', ] : [], diff --git a/tasks/jenkins.js b/tasks/jenkins.js index e3d3d9c3cc06d..801cece75d875 100644 --- a/tasks/jenkins.js +++ b/tasks/jenkins.js @@ -1,9 +1,12 @@ module.exports = function (grunt) { let { compact } = require('lodash'); - grunt.registerTask('jenkins', 'Jenkins build script', compact([ - 'test', - process.env.JOB_NAME === 'kibana_core' ? 'build:ospackages' : null - ])); + grunt.registerTask('jenkins', 'Jenkins build script', function () { + grunt.option('os-packages', true); + grunt.task.run(compact([ + 'test', + process.env.JOB_NAME === 'kibana_core' ? 'build' : null + ])); + }); };